Penwork Kalamkari dupattas are created slowly, entirely by hand. Unlike block-printed Kalamkari, these motifs are drawn freehand using a pen made from tamarind twigs. Every line is intentional. Every curve is guided by the hand. Shipped Worldwide! The fabric is first treated to accept natural dyes. Motifs are then drawn one section at a time, dyed, washed, and dried repeatedly. This layered process gives Pen Kalamkari its depth and clarity. Colours settle into the cloth instead of sitting on the surface. Because each motif is hand-drawn, no two dupattas are identical. Slight shifts in line thickness or spacing are natural and expected. They confirm the human hand behind the work. The cotton or silk base remains breathable and soft, making these dupattas easy to wear and layer. Over time, the fabric softens further while the colours remain grounded.
